Bernie Sanders didn't win an endorsement from Chicago Mayor Rahm Emanuel, and he's thrilled about it. In fact, the Democratic presidential hopeful went so far as to thank him for backing his rival, Hillary Clinton:
Sanders, who has been campaigning in Illinois ahead of Tuesday's primary, also called out Emanuel in a news conference Saturday. Emanuel has long been criticized for budget cuts across Chicago Public Schools. More recently, he's come under fire for the city's delay in releasing video footage of the fatal shooting of a black teenager, Laquan McDonald, at the hands of a police officer.
